Progressive 440 13" question ?

I am going to put the Progressive 440-2413 hd on my nomad ( they have to be made to fit I know ) This shock is for the vulcan classic !
So I my question is what to do to make it fit? I know about Gadgets fix. I would like to hear from someone who has done this shock change themselves. Thanks Caper------Donnie

Progressive 440 13" question ?

Call Progressive, they will sell you a piece that adapts the top of the shock to the 1600 mount.

Scott, a buddy of mine in TX found out the hard way that if you don't have it you can break the stud.

Some have made their own bushing for the top mount.

Progressive 440 13" question ?

When with the 416's 13" for the Valkyrie - it came with the proper sizes bushings ( many sizes in kit) and the only thing was to add washers as needed to capture the eyeltes as they are smaller length. I am very happy with them and the bike has never ridden so good! Plus, with the trailer and ole lady on board the bike doesn't bottom out now. Before even at max pressure the damn thing would bottom out on big bumps but also would ride rough at that pressure!
